If “The Columbus Way” were a river, its source might just be The Columbus Partnership. Founded in 2002 as a non-profit organization, the Partnership is a collaborative civic institution that brings the CEOs of Columbus’ leading businesses and institutions together in common purpose to advance metro-wide prosperity. Its work spans economic development, innovation, and efforts to shape an expanding opportunity economy and dynamic community for all. In January 2025, the Columbus Partnership welcomed only its fourth Chief Executive Officer, Jason Hall. The former CEO of Greater St. Louis, Inc., Hall was known for his innovation, collaboration, and results, including stewarding the St. Louis metro to a top 5 job growth market for the first time since 1990 while also catalyzing bold investments in under-invested neighborhoods.
